The government unveiled $67 billion in new spending … mount vernon overhead door mount vernon ohioWebApr 19, 2024 · The federal government estimates that total budgetary revenues will be $409 billion for the fiscal year, and total budgetary expenses will be $462 billion. Thus, total budgetary expenses will need to be financed by a $53-billion deficit. This deficit represents about 11% of the total budget.
